A fatal collision in Pomona claimed the life of a motorcyclist on Sunday afternoon when the motorcyclist's bike was struck by a car. The incident, which occurred near Indian Hill Boulevard and Kingsley Avenue just after 12:30 p.m., led to the motorcyclist sustaining severe injuries. According to the Pomona Police Department, attempts to save the rider's life were unsuccessful, and the individual was declared dead at the scene. The information regarding this tragic event was detailed in a statement obtained by CBS News Los Angeles.

The exact circumstances surrounding the crash are still to be unraveled, but initial reports indicate that drugs and/or alcohol were not involved. The other driver involved in the collision was transported to a nearby hospital, sustaining only minor injuries. This information was corroborated by a separate report from the Pomona Police Department, emphasizing the ongoing investigation by their Major Accident Investigation Team.

The identity of the motorcyclist has been withheld pending notification of next of kin.
